Chapter 1.General Information
1-1. General Guidelines
When servicing, observe the original lead dress. Ifa short circuit is found, replace all parts which
have been overheated or damaged by the short circuit.
After servicing, see to it that all the protective devices such as insulation barriers, insulation papers
shields are properly installed.
After servicing, make the following leakage current checks to prevent the customer from being
exposed to shock hazards.
1) Leakage Current Cold Check
2) Leakage Current Hot Check
3) Prevention of Electro Static Discharge (ESD) to Electrostatically Sensitive
1-2. Important Notice
1-2-1. Follow the regulations and warnings
Most important thing is to list up the potential hazard or risk for the service personnel to open the units and disassemble the units. For example, we need to describe properly how to avoid the possibility to get electrical shock from the live power supply or charged electrical parts (even the power is off).
This symbol indicates that high voltage is present inside.It is dangerous to make any
kind of contact with any inside part of this product.
This symbol indicates that there are important operatingand maintenance instructions
in the literture accompanying the appliance.
1-2-2. Be careful to the electrical shock
To pr ev ent d amage which might result in electric shock or fire, do not expose this TV set to rain or excessive moisture. This TV must not be exposed to dripping or splashingwater, and objects fi lled with liquid, such as vases, must not be placed on top of or above the TV.
1-2-3. Electro static discharge (ESD)
Some semiconductor (solid state) devices can be damaged easily by static electricity. Such components commonly are called Electrostatically Sensitive (ES) Devices. The following techniques should be used to help reduce the incidence of component damage caused by electros static discharge (ESD).

Electrostatically Sensitive (ES) Devices
Some semiconductor (solid-state) devices can be damaged easily by static electricity. Such components commonly are called Electrostatically Sensitive (ES) Devices. Examples of typical ES devices are integrated circuits and some field-effect transistors and semiconductor "chip" components. The following techniques should be used to help reduce the ncidence of component damage caused by static by static electricity.
1. Immediately before handlingany semiconductor component or semiconductor-equipped
assembly, drain off any electrostatic charge on your body by touchinga known earth ground. Alternatively, obtain and wear a commercially available dischargingwrist strap device, which
should be removed to prevent potential shock reasons prior to applying power to the unit under test.
2. After removingan electrical assembly equipped with ES devices, place the assembly on a conductive surface such as aluminumfoil, to prevent electrostatic charge buildup or exposure of the assembly.
1-2-4. About lead free solder (PbF)
This product is manufactured using lead-free solder as a part ofamovement within the consumer products industry at large to be environmentally responsible. Lead-free solder must be used in the servicingand repairing of this product.
1-2-5. Use the genewing parts (specifi ed parts)
Special parts which have purposes of fi re retardant (resistors), high-quality sound (capacitors), low noise (resistors), etc. are used.
When replacingany of components, be sure to use only manufacture's specifi ed parts shown in the parts list.
Safety Component
Ɣ Components identifi ed by mark have special characteristics important for safety.
1-2-6. Safety check after repairment
Confi rm that the screws, parts and wiringwhich were removed in order to service are put in the original positions, or whether there are the positions which are deteriorated around the serviced places serviced or not. Check the insulation between the antenna terminal or external metal and the AC cord plug blades. And be sure the safety of that.

13. Use only an anti-static type solder removal device. Some solder removal devices not
classifi ed as "anti-static" can generate electrical charges suffi c i e n t t o d amage ES devices.
14. Do not use freon-propelled chemicals. These can generate electrical charges sufficient to
damage ES devices.
15. Do not remove a replacement ES device from its protective package until immediately
before you are ready to install it.
(Most replacement ES devices are packaged with leads electrically shorted together by
conductive foam, aluminumfoil or comparable conductive material).
16. Immediately before removing the protective material from the leads ofa replacement ES
device, touch the protective material to the chassis or circuit assembly into which the device will be installed.
CAUTION:
precautions.
17. Minimize bodily motions when handling unpackaged replacement ES devices. (Otherwise
harmless motion such as the brushing together of your clothes fabric or the lifting of your foot froma carpeted fl oor can generate static electricity suffi c i e n t t o d amage an ES device.)

Chapter 7. Measurements and Adjustments
7
-1. Service Mode
(Modo de Serviço)
Service Manual
HBTV-32D03 / 42D03
7
7
7
-2. Measurements and Adjustments
Como entrar no modo de serviço:
-1-1.
P
elo controle remoto do TV, digite na sequencia as teclas:
MENU 8 8 9 3
A
seguinte informação aparecerá na tela, conforme ilustração abaixo. N
opção “Info de Versão”
LCD, como no exemplo ao lado:
-1-2.
Sair do modo de serviço:
P
ara sair do modo de serviço, aperte a tecla EXIT do controle remoto, ou
simplesmente desligue o aparelho.
aparecerá o modelo do processador e da tela de
” L_M
TK5363
15XW03V5_BRA
_AU3
a
”.
(Medições e Ajustes)
NÃO HÁ AJUSTES A SEREM REALIZADOS NESTE MODO. RECOMENDA-SE NÃO ALTERAR NENHUM VALOR PRÉ-DEFINIDO DE FÁBRICA, SOB RISCO DE MAL FUNCIO­NAMENTO.
7
-2-1.
Reinicializando a memória:
Para reinicializar a Placa Principal, após a atualização de software, troca da memória flash, placa principal ou se o equipamento apresentar funcionamento instável, utilize a função "Limpar Memó- ria" Pressione no controle remoto as teclas direcionais “^ / Storage ",então pressione a tecla "> ".
NOTA: Após aplicar a reinicialização, desligue o TV
por alguns segundos e religue.
até a opção "Clean

Chapter 8.
Firmware Update (Atualização de programa):
8-1. IIInnniiitttiiiaaalll CCCaaarrreee (Cuuuiiidddaaadddooosss Innniiiccciiiaaaiiisss):::
Este procedimento a seguir somente deve ser executado quando o equipamento apresentar anormalidade em sua operação, ou quando houver um comunicado oficial para realizar tal proce­dimento. Não faça a atualização se o equipamento estiver funcionando corretamente. Leia atentamente o procedimento todo e execute a tarefa conforme descrito a seguir. Em caso de dúvidas, solicite sempre o auxílio do suporte técnico da H-Buster.
NUNCA FAÇA ESSE PROCEDIMENTO SE A REDE ELÉTRICA ESTIVER INSTÁVEL, SOB RISCO DE DANO IRREVERSÍVEL À MEMÓRIA
OU MESMO A PLACA PRINCIPAL.
RECOMENDAMOS O USO DE NO-BREAK PARA A SEGURANÇA DO EQUIPAMENTO.
8-2. Innniiitttiiiaaalll Proooccceeeddduuureeesss (Proooccceeedddiiimmmeeennntttooosss Innniiiccciiiaaaiiisss):::
8-2-1. Needed tools (Ferramentas necessárias):
- Um pen-drive vazio e formatado (FAT32) - mínimo 512MB;
- Controle remoto do equipamento;
- Versão mais recente baixada do site de serviços.
Para obter a versão mais recente, entre no site de serviços da H-Buster e faça o download conforme o modelo do equipamento e do painel de LCD (se houver). Em caso de dúvidas, entre em contato com o suporte técnico.
Links para o download dos softwares dos modelos (é preciso estar logado na Página de serviços):
HBTV-32D03HD: http://autorizadas.hbuster.com.br/pages/visualizarArquivo.aspx?arquivo=972
HBTV-42D03FD: http://autorizadas.hbuster.com.br/pages/visualizarArquivo.aspx?arquivo=1040
8-2-2. How to identify the Panel Type (Como identificar o modelo de painel de LCD):
8-2-2-1. Service Mode Menu (menu do modo de serviço):
48
Fig. 8-1. Menu de serviços inicial Fig. 8-2. Info de versão
Page 51
Service Manual
HBTV-32D03 / 42D03
8-2-2-2. Rear side of LCD Panel (lado traseiro do painel de LCD):
Fig. 8-3. Identificação do painel de LCD pela etiqueta colada no verso (parte interna).
NOTA: OS EXEMPLOS APRESENTADOS ACIMA SÃO MERAMENTE INFORMATIVOS. SEMPRE EXECUTE O PROCEDIMENTO ACIMA PARA EVITAR ERROS NO PEDIDO.
8-2-3. Copying the firmware to USB Memory Key (copiando o programa no pen-drive):
O arquivo que está no site de serviços está “zipado (compactado).” Para descompactá-lo, é ne­cessário ter instalado em seu computador um programa descompactador (ex.: Winzip, WinRAR,
etc.) Salve no desktop e descompacte-o no PC. Se o programa descompactador criar uma pasta,
abra a pasta e copie para o pen-drive o arquivo que está dentro da pasta (NÃO COPIE A PASTA
TODA).
O nome do arquivo a ser copiado para o pen-drive NÃO DEVE SER ALTERADO, CASO CONTRÁRIO O TV NÃO IRÁ RECONHECER O ARQUIVO!
8-3. Updating the firmware (Atualizando o programa):-
Siga os procedimentos abaixo atentamente:
1) Com o TV funcionando, conecte o pen-drive com o prgrama gravado, na porta USB;
2) Após alguns segundos, abrirá uma "janela" informando se deseja atualizar o software da TV, selecione "SIM" e aperte OK no controle;
3) Após confirmar, aparecerá na tela "Atualizando...". Aguarde até o final;
4) Ao término, desligue o equipamento pelo botão POWER e religue;
5) Entre no menu de serviços e faça a reinicialização da memória com o comando LIMPAR MEMÓRIA. (consulte o capítulo 7 para maiores detalhes).
CUIDADO!!! DURANTE A ATUALIZAÇÃO
NUNCA RETIRE DA TOMADA OU DESLIGUE O APARELHO!!! (LEIA A ADVERTÊNCIA NO INÍCIO DESTE CAPÍTULO)
